网站访问速度慢是许多网站管理员和用户都可能会遇到的问题,它不仅影响用户体验,还可能对搜索引擎优化(SEO)产生负面影响,以下是导致网站访问速度缓慢的四大原因及相应的技术介绍:
网站运行的服务器性能直接影响着网站的响应时间,如果服务器硬件过时、资源分配不合理,或者服务器负载过高,都可能导致网站处理请求的速度变慢。
1、硬件限制:服务器的CPU、内存和存储设备等硬件配置如果不足以处理当前的访问量,会导致网站响应迟缓。
2、带宽限制:服务器的网络带宽不足也是造成访问速度慢的一个原因,特别是在流量高峰期。
3、资源分配:虚拟主机上的资源分配策略会影响单个网站可用的资源,如CPU使用时间和内存限制。
数据从服务器传输到用户的浏览器需要经过多个网络节点,任何一个节点的问题都可能引起延迟。
1、网络拥堵:互联网服务提供商(ISP)的网络拥堵或维护工作可以导致数据传输延迟。
2、路由效率:数据包在互联网上传输时,其路径(路由)并非总是最优化的,差的路由会增加延迟时间。
3、地理位置:用户与服务器之间的地理距离也会影响网站加载速度,距离越远,通常延迟越高。
即使服务器和网络状况良好,网站本身的设计和编码不佳也会导致加载速度变慢。
1、代码臃肿:页面中含有大量不必要的代码,如冗长的JavaScript和CSS文件,会延长加载时间。
2、图片和媒体文件:未优化的大尺寸图片和多媒体文件会占用大量带宽,减慢网站加载速度。
3、插件和第三方服务:过多的插件或第三方服务(如社交媒体按钮)可能会增加HTTP请求的数量,拖慢网站速度。
动态网站经常需要从数据库中检索信息,如果数据库查询效率低,就会增加页面加载时间。
1、查询优化:没有正确索引或查询语句编写不当,会导致数据库检索数据变慢。
2、数据库大小:随着数据量的增加,数据库的查询速度可能会下降。
3、并发连接数:如果同时有太多请求访问数据库,可能会导致数据库响应变慢。
相关问题与解答:
Q1: 如何检测网站访问速度慢的具体原因?
A1: 可以使用网站速度测试工具,如Google PageSpeed Insights、GTmetrix等,它们可以提供关于网站性能的详细报告。
Q2: 有哪些方法可以提高服务器性能?
A2: 可以考虑升级服务器硬件、优化资源配置、使用负载均衡技术分散请求压力,或者选择更优质的托管服务。
Q3: 如何减少网页中的HTTP请求?
A3: 合并CSS和JavaScript文件、优化图片使用、移除不必要的插件和脚本,以及使用CSS Sprite技术可以减少HTTP请求数量。
Q4: 数据库查询效率低应该如何解决?
A4: 优化查询语句、为常用查询字段创建索引、定期清理和维护数据库、以及使用缓存机制都是提高数据库查询效率的有效方法。
文章题目:网站访问速度慢的四大原因是什么
URL地址:http://www.shufengxianlan.com/qtweb/news21/366371.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联